gpt4 book ai didi

jquery - 如何在 jQuery ajax() 调用中传递多个 JavaScript 数据变量?

转载 作者:行者123 更新时间:2023-12-03 22:13:43 25 4
gpt4 key购买 nike

如果 startDateTimeendDateTime 的日期时间值与此类似:

Start: Mon Jan 10 2011 18:15:00 GMT+0000 (GMT Standard Time)
End: Mon Jan 10 2011 18:45:00 GMT+0000 (GMT Standard Time)

如何将 startDateTimeendDateTime 传递给下面的 ajax 调用?

eventNew : function(calEvent, event) 
{
var startDateTime = calEvent.start;
var endDateTime = calEvent.end;
jQuery.ajax(
{
url: '/eventnew/',
cache: false,
data: /** How to pass startDateTime & endDateTime here? */,
type: 'POST',
success: function(response)
{
// do something with response
}
});

},

最佳答案

尝试:

data: {
start: startDateTime,
end: endDateTime
}

这将在您可以使用的服务器上创建“start”和“end”请求参数。

{...}object literal ,这是创建对象的简单方法。 .ajax函数获取对象并将其属性(在本例中为“start”和“end”)转换为键/值对,这些键/值对设置为发送到服务器的 HTTP 请求的属性。

关于jquery - 如何在 jQuery ajax() 调用中传递多个 JavaScript 数据变量?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/4663341/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com